ACES, a zwitterionic buffer, possesses a pKa of 6.8, making it highly effective for buffering biological systems within the pH range of 6.1 to 7.5. This specific range is often optimal for enzyme activity and protein stability, thus making ACES a go-to buffer for many experimental protocols. The utility of ACES spans across various critical areas of biochemical research. In enzyme assays, the precise pH control offered by ACES is indispensable for obtaining reliable kinetic data. Enzymes are notoriously sensitive to pH, and ACES provides the stable environment needed to observe their true catalytic rates. Similarly, in protein characterization and analysis, ACES buffer contributes to accurate separation and resolution, aiding in the elucidation of protein structures and functions. Moreover, ACES is valued for its compatibility with biological systems and its relatively low interaction with metal ions, which can be a significant advantage in experiments where metal ion concentrations are critical. This makes it a robust buffer for cell culture, electrophoresis, and other sensitive biochemical procedures.
